Pulitzer Building New York Many have read the story of the wi.se old cwl who sat in an yak. who held his own tongue but saw and heard a great deal, yet few of us rr haps realize the virtue of such ad vice' as "think more and say less' until we have had the lesson brought .home to us in some impressie way. The new picture at the Pastime thea tre today and tomorrow .which is en titled ''The Furnace." and is a new Rcilart Special Production by Will iam D. Taylor, smashes this lesson home in ?i ay that many will remem ber for a long: time to come. In that .production, which is based o nthc new novel by the Englis.li au thor "Pan," the idle threat made iust before her marriags by Folly Val- lance. a popular London actress and the ride-to-be of Anthony Bond, a wealthy social favorite, is the basis for all . the tragedy that follows the nrariiasrc- The girl was heard to re mark lightly that if Anthony jilted her. she would sue ;him for breach of promise. This was said in jest, but when the girls finance heard cf her remark, just l efore the iveldinr, He interpreted it as meaning that the girl did not really love him. He goes ahead with the marriage but repud iates her as his wife. Some of " the most powerful dramatic situations ever screened folks the estrange ment. Agnes Ayres plays the role of Folly Vallance and Anthony Bond is ably portrayed by Jerome Patrick, the well-known legitimate star and screen favorite. Theodore Roberts, Helen Dunbar. Betty Francisco, Mil tonSills. Fred Turner, Mayme Kelso. Lucien Littlefield. Rober Bolder nd' ether favorites also 'appear in the all-star cast. Julia Crawford Ivera wrote hc scenario and Jmes C. Van Trees ie lespcnsible for the remarkable pho tography.
